At regular meetings your child should wear the uniform below with casual bottoms. Guidance on the expected uniform for specific activities will be provided as needed.
Our Group neckerchief is Red & Gold. These are provided by the Group.
For activity wear there is a choice of optional polo shirts, available in turquoise for Beaver
Scouts and green for Cub Scouts and Scouts.
Uniform can be purchased online from https://shop.scouts.org.uk/. A number of school outfitters also stock Scout uniforms.
A kit list with links to retailers will be issued to you.
The Group necker, initial badges and woggle will be supplied to you at cost for £10 payable through OSM prior to your child’s investiture into their Section.
If you are taking part in amazing activities, then you will want something to prove you have done them. Badges and awards are a huge part of Scouting, providing a framework of ideas for Leaders to follow and recognition to the young people for their achievements. There’s never any pressure to do badges. You can do as many or as few as they like. But for those up for a challenge, there are loads of exciting badges to aim for, such as the Chief Scout's Bronze, Silver and Gold Awards – these are the highest awards that Beavers, Cubs and Scouts can earn. And for those going even further, the Queen’s Scout Award is the top achievement for young people in Scouts.
